Enteric fever, primarily caused by Salmonella Typhi and Salmonella Paratyphi, remains a significant health concern worldwide, particularly in developing countries. Despite advances in healthcare, effective management of enteric fever in clinical practice remains challenging. This article aims to explore the most effective strategies for managing this condition.
Rapid and accurate diagnosis is the cornerstone of effective management. Blood culture remains the gold standard for diagnosis, but its sensitivity can be limited. Newer diagnostic techniques, such as PCR and serological tests, offer promising alternatives.
Antibiotic therapy is the mainstay of treatment for enteric fever. However, the increasing prevalence of multidrug-resistant strains requires careful antibiotic selection. Fluoroquinolones, third-generation cephalosporins, and azithromycin are currently the drugs of choice.
Vaccination is a crucial preventive measure. Two vaccines - the oral live attenuated Ty21a vaccine and the injectable Vi polysaccharide vaccine - are currently available. However, their efficacy varies, and they are not suitable for all populations. Continued research into more effective vaccines is needed.
Public health measures, such as improved sanitation and safe drinking water, play a significant role in preventing enteric fever. These measures are particularly important in endemic areas where antibiotic resistance is high.
Effective management of enteric fever requires a multifaceted approach, including accurate diagnosis, appropriate antibiotic therapy, vaccination, and public health measures. Clinicians must stay abreast of the latest developments in diagnosis and treatment, while public health initiatives must focus on prevention. As antibiotic resistance continues to rise, the need for new treatment strategies and vaccines becomes increasingly urgent.
